From middle english sacren, sakeren, from old french sacrer (“to hallow”), from latin sacrō (“to make sacred, consecrate”), from sacer (“sacred, holy”). The noun sacre refers to the act of consecration or anointing, particularly in religious ceremonies, while the verb form sacrer means to consecrate or to make sacred.
